Skip to content

Teamtailor Integration

Skima AI helps recruitment teams automate workflows, prioritize candidates using AI scoring, and streamline hiring operations. With the Teamtailor integration, you can sync candidates, jobs, applications, and notes from Teamtailor into Skima AI, automate repetitive tasks, and manage pipelines from one place.

Setting Up the Integration

This section guides you through connecting your Teamtailor account with Skima AI. Once connected, Skima AI will begin syncing your Teamtailor candidates, jobs, and applications so you can use workflow automation within Skima AI.

Step 1: Generate your Teamtailor API Key

You need a Teamtailor API key before starting setup in Skima AI. You must be a Company Admin in Teamtailor to complete this step.

Info

To confirm you have Company Admin access, navigate to Settings in Teamtailor. If you can see the 'API Keys' option under Integrations, you have the required access. If not, contact your Teamtailor administrator before proceeding.

  1. Log in to Teamtailor and navigate to Settings → Integrations → API Keys.

  1. Click '+ New API Key' in the top-right corner.
  2. Give the key a recognizable name, such as Skima AI.
  3. Set the Permission to Admin.
Info

Skima AI syncs candidate data, which is restricted to Admin-scoped keys only in Teamtailor. Public and Internal keys will not grant the access required for this integration to function.

  1. Set the Access to Read and Write.
Info

Read access allows Skima AI to pull your candidates, jobs, and applications. Write access is required for Skima AI to push AI scores, tags, and notes back into Teamtailor.

  1. Click 'Create' to generate the key.
  2. Copy the key immediately and store it securely. Teamtailor displays the API key only once, it cannot be viewed again after you close this screen. If lost, you will need to delete and recreate the key.

  1. On the API Keys page, note the Base URL for the API displayed at the top of the page. You will need to enter this in Skima AI during setup.
Info

The Base URL reflects the region where your Teamtailor account data is stored. Common values are https://api.teamtailor.com/v1/ (Europe), https://api.na.teamtailor.com/v1/ (North America), and https://api.au.teamtailor.com/v1/ (Asia-Pacific). Copy it directly from the page rather than typing it manually.

Step 2: Connect Teamtailor in Skima AI

  1. Log in to your Skima AI dashboard.

  2. Navigate to 'Integrations' from the left sidebar.

Skima AI left sidebar showing the Integrations navigation option

  1. Search for 'Teamtailor' or scroll through the ATS integrations list.

  2. Click 'Add' to begin the setup process.

Teamtailor integration card in Skima AI Integrations page with Add button to begin setup

  1. Review the permissions Skima AI requires. These include Candidates, Jobs, Applications, Attachments, Stages, Users, Departments, Notes, and Tags, the minimum set needed to sync your pipeline and enable workflow automation.

  2. Click 'Proceed' to continue.

Teamtailor integration permissions review screen showing required data access with Proceed button

  1. Enter your Teamtailor credentials: Admin Email ID, Teamtailor API Key, and Teamtailor API URL.

Teamtailor credentials entry form with fields for admin email ID, API key, and API URL

  1. After successful authorization, Teamtailor will appear under the 'My Integrations' tab in Skima AI, confirming the integration is active and syncing.

My Integrations tab showing Teamtailor integration as active and syncing

Using the Integration

Once your Teamtailor account is connected, Skima AI begins ingesting candidates, jobs, applications, and notes. This enables Skima AI to evaluate candidate and job fit, generate AI match scores, and support workflow automation. The initial sync may take some time depending on the volume of data in your Teamtailor account. You can monitor sync status from the Teamtailor card under 'My Integrations'.

Application Stage Sync

Skima AI keeps application stages aligned with Teamtailor through scheduled sync cycles. Since Teamtailor's stages are tied to individual job applications, Skima AI reads stage updates through job-application records during each sync.

During each sync, Skima AI updates application stages pulled from Teamtailor, refreshes candidate and job data including job descriptions, syncs notes, attachments, and applications, and updates scores based on newly synced information.

Info

Supported sync intervals are 6 hours, 12 hours, and 24 hours. To configure your preferred frequency, open the Teamtailor card under 'My Integrations' and select your interval from the integration settings.

Jobs

Teamtailor jobs are imported into Skima AI, including full job descriptions, to support candidate and job matching and reporting.

Skima AI jobs view showing Teamtailor-imported jobs with matching data

Candidates and Applications

Skima AI can also push updates back to Teamtailor, including custom fields, tags, and notes added during the matching process.

Custom Fields let you push AI scores and match reasons into Teamtailor as structured data against each candidate record. To use this, create the relevant custom fields in Teamtailor first, then map them to Skima AI outputs from the integration settings inside the Teamtailor card in 'My Integrations'.

![Custom fields configuration in Teamtailor showing AI score and notes push from Skima AI]

Tags let you push AI scores into Teamtailor as candidate tags for quick filtering and categorization. Tag values are written back automatically once tag push-back is enabled from the integration settings.

![Tags configuration in Teamtailor showing AI score push from Skima AI using tags]

Notes send matching analysis from Skima AI back into Teamtailor so that actions taken in Skima AI are reflected in Teamtailor's activity timeline. Notes are pushed back automatically once enabled from the integration settings.

![Teamtailor activity timeline showing Skima AI matching analysis notes pushed back to Teamtailor]

Disabling the Integration

If you need to stop syncing Teamtailor data or remove the integration entirely, you can disable the connection from either Skima AI or Teamtailor.

Warning

If you only want to temporarily stop syncing, use the Pause option inside Skima AI rather than disabling from Teamtailor. Deleting the API key in Teamtailor fully removes authorization and requires you to go through the full setup process again to reconnect.

In Skima AI

  1. Navigate to 'Integrations' from the left sidebar.
  2. Find Teamtailor under 'My Integrations'.
  3. Click 'Pause' to pause the sync.

My Integrations page showing Teamtailor integration with Pause option to stop syncing

In Teamtailor

To remove the key, refer to Teamtailor's API documentation for the steps applicable to your account.

After Disconnecting

Previously synced Teamtailor data remains available in Skima AI. New data will no longer sync, and Skima AI will stop sending updates back to Teamtailor. If you reconnect later, you will need to complete the setup process again from Step 1.